Step 1: Assessment and Containment
We’ll quickly assess the situation, identify the source of the problem, and contain the affected area to prevent further damage and health risks. Our technicians are trained to spot potential hazards and take steps to mitigate them.
Step 2: Water Removal and Drying
Our equipment is designed to extract water quickly and efficiently, reducing downtime and preventing further damage. We’ll also use specialized drying equipment to ensure your property is completely dry and free of moisture.
Step 3: Sanitizing and Disinfecting
We’ll use spec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to sanitize and disinfect the affected area, ensuring that all surfaces are free of bacteria, viruses, and other microorganisms.
Step 4: Reconstruction and Repair
Once the affected area is clean and dry, our team will work with you to repair and reconstruct any damaged areas. This may include replacing flooring, walls, or other structural elements.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Quality Control
We’ll conduct a thorough final inspection to ensure that your property is safe, clean, and free of any remaining damage or health risks.

Sewage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Sewage backup in a small area | Yes | No | DIY cleaning and disinfecting can be effective in small areas. |
| Large-scale sewage water damage | No | Yes | Professional equipment and expertise are needed to handle large-scale damage. |
| Hidden sewage damage | No | Yes | Hidden damage can be difficult to detect and needs professional expertise to locate and repair. |
| Health risks or biohazards | No | Yes | Professional equipment and expertise are needed to safely handle health risks and biohazards. |
| Insurance claims | No | Yes | Professional documentation and expertise are needed to ensure smooth insurance claims processing. |
| Time-sensitive situations | No | Yes | Professional teams can respond quickly to time-sensitive situations, reducing downtime and further damage. |

Common Questions About Sewage Water Removal
What causes sewage water damage?
Sewage water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including clogged pipes, overflowing toilets, and heavy rainfall. If you notice any signs of sewage water damage, don’t wait, call us for help.
How long does sewage water removal take?
The length of time it takes to complete sewage water removal services depends on the severity and size of the affected area. Our team will work with you to develop a customized plan and ensure that your property is safe and clean as quickly as possible.
Is sewage water removal covered by insurance?
Yes, sewage water removal is typically covered by homeowner’s insurance policies. Our team will work with you and your insurance company to ensure smooth claims processing and reduce your out-of-pocket costs.
What are the health risks associated with sewage water damage?
Sewage water damage can pose serious health risks, including exposure to bacteria, viruses, and other microorganisms. If you suspect sewage water damage, don’t wait, call us for help and ensure that your property is safe and clean.
How do I prevent sewage water damage?
Preventing sewage water damage needs regular maintenance and inspections of your plumbing system. Our team can help you develop a maintenance plan and identify potential issues before they become major problems.
